AAS 2014 Annual Conference
AAS 2014 Annual Conference
March 27-30, 2014 * Philadelphia, PA
Philadelphia Marriott Downtown


The Association for Asian Studies (AAS) is pleased to invite colleagues in Asian Studies and other interested persons attend the AAS 2014 Annual Conference at the Philadelphia Downtown Marriott, as we present 360 Organized Panels, Roundtables, Workshops.

The Annual Conference program will also consist of two Keynote Addresses, a Presidential Address and Awards Ceremony, Film Screenings and receptions.
